Actually, I just need a little black cog which prevents the sunglass
holder from dropping fast. It is connected to the starboard side of
the Sunglass/Maplight Assembly.

The cog is about 1/4" ~ 3/8" in diameter and is just mounted on a post
with enough friction to make it rotate slow. It clips into the assy.

I spoke to my local Honda dealer and he says that I have to buy the
entire assy.

Anyone have a source for this small part?

Don't know what year your CR-V is, but as of the '06 model year (the year of
my CR-V) there were only two different models of the sunglass holder & they
have interchangeable parts.  You can also use the ones with the built in
homelink if you want.

I upgraded mine on ebay for $20 to get the homelink, but for your purposes,
you should be able to get the part you need from virtually any Honda you
find in the junkyard that has a sunglass holder.

Now if your CR-V is '07 or newer, YMMV, but I would still start at the
junkyard.
